Banking & Finance in India Course is a 8 weeks online beginner-level course on Coursera by O.P. Jindal Global University that covers finance. This course provides a solid foundation in India's banking and financial systems, ideal for beginners seeking clarity on institutional frameworks and market dynamics. The content is well-structured and informative, though it lacks advanced technical depth. Learners gain valuable context on regulatory bodies and emerging fintech trends. Best suited for those interested in foundational knowledge rather than hands-on financial modeling. We rate it 8.0/10.

## What will you learn in Banking & Finance in India Course

- Understand the role of money and monetary policy in the Indian economy

- Distinguish between public and private finances and their economic impact

- Explain the structure and functions of the Indian banking system

- Identify key financial market instruments and their operational mechanisms

- Analyze government budgets and their influence on national finances

### Program Overview

### Module 1: Money and Monetary Policy (2.9h)

2.9h

- Introduction to course structure and learning outcomes

- Understanding money and its functions in economy

- Overview of monetary policy and its instruments

### Module 2: Basic Idea of Public Finances (3.9h)

3.9h

- Distinguish between public and private finances

- Understand government budgeting and fiscal impact

- Explore how public spending affects economy

### Module 3: Banking System in India (5.3h)

5.3h

- Learn structure of banking system in India

- Identify types of banks and their roles

- Explore bank accounts, deposits, and sector ratios

### Module 4: Financial Markets (3.1h)

3.1h

- Understand basic financial market concepts

- Study money market and short-term funding instruments

- Learn about capital markets and bond types

## Editorial Take

The 'Banking & Finance in India' course delivers a foundational yet thorough exploration of the country’s financial architecture, making it a valuable resource for learners new to the domain. Offered through Coursera by O.P. Jindal Global University, it balances institutional knowledge with emerging trends in digital finance.

### Standout Strengths

- Regulatory Clarity: The course clearly outlines the roles of key regulators like the Reserve Bank of India, SEBI, and IRDAI, helping learners understand how financial stability and investor protection are maintained. This structured regulatory overview is rare in beginner-level courses.

- Systematic Structure: With a well-organized module flow from banking fundamentals to financial markets and fintech, the course builds knowledge progressively. Each section reinforces prior learning, enhancing retention and conceptual clarity for new learners.

- Focus on Financial Inclusion: The inclusion of financial literacy and digital banking trends reflects a socially conscious approach to finance education. It highlights government initiatives like Jan Dhan Yojana and their impact on underserved populations.

- Accessibility: Being free to audit lowers the barrier to entry, making it ideal for students, career switchers, or professionals in India seeking foundational knowledge. The English delivery ensures broad reach across regions.

- Institutional Credibility: Backed by O.P. Jindal Global University, the course benefits from academic rigor and real-world relevance. The content reflects current policy frameworks and regulatory updates, adding authenticity.

- Globalization Context: The course connects India’s financial evolution with globalization trends, explaining cross-border capital flows and trade finance implications. This adds contextual depth beyond domestic operations.

### Honest Limitations

- Limited Practical Application: While conceptually strong, the course lacks hands-on exercises such as reading balance sheets or analyzing stock market data. Learners seeking skill-based training may find it too theoretical for immediate job application.

- Shallow Fintech Coverage: Although it introduces digital banking and fintech, the treatment remains surface-level. Topics like blockchain, AI in credit scoring, or neobanking are mentioned but not explored in technical or operational detail.

- No Advanced Financial Tools: The course avoids complex financial instruments like credit derivatives or structured products. This keeps it beginner-friendly but limits usefulness for those aiming for roles in investment banking or portfolio management.

- Minimal International Benchmarking: There is little comparison with global financial systems, which could have enriched understanding of India’s unique challenges and reforms. A broader perspective would enhance strategic insights for global professionals.

### Supplementary Resources

- Book: 'Indian Financial System' by Bharati V. Pathak offers deeper insights into market mechanisms and policy evolution. It’s an excellent companion for expanding beyond course content.

- Tool: Explore the RBI’s official website for access to monetary policy reports, financial stability reviews, and regulatory updates. Real-time data enriches theoretical learning.

- Follow-up: Enroll in Coursera’s 'Financial Markets' by Yale University to build on this foundation with global perspectives and investment strategies.

- Reference: Follow SEBI’s investor education portal (investor.sebi.gov.in) for practical guides on mutual funds, stocks, and fraud prevention. It bridges academic knowledge with real-world application.
